eBay Loses Key PayPal Executive to Google
After eight years at PayPal, Osama Bedier has left the company and is taking on a new role at Google. He will be replaced at PayPal by Matthew Mengerink, who has previously led the PayPal architecture, infrastructure, payments development, core technologies, international development and customer quality and engineering services teams.
Bedier helped open the PayPal platform to developers 2 years ago. Bedier started at PayPal in 2003 as an engineer and spent years championing the idea of an open platform until he was promoted and given the resources to make it happen.
Bedier was PayPal Vice President of Mobile, Platform and New Ventures, and it will be interesting to see what role he assumes at Google, which is focused on mobile and local and offers its own payment processing service, Google Checkout
